4 numbers that are divisible by both 2 and 9

Respuesta :

FraydaZ188815 FraydaZ188815
  • 03-11-2022

A Number to be divisible by 2, the last digit must be even.

divisible by 9 = sum of the digits must be divisible by 9:

So, 4 numbers:

18,36,54,72
